CONSUMER RIGHTS IN INDIAN REAL ESTATE MARKET ISSUES AND CHALLENGES IN INDIAN HOUSING MARKET
1 Author(s): DR. SURAJ KUMAR
Vol - 5, Issue- 8 , Page(s) : 183 - 192 (2014 ) DOI : https://doi.org/10.32804/IRJMSH
Indian housing market has historically been lopsided against the property buyers. In the lack of appropriate regulatory framework, developers undertake unfair market practices and benefit at the cost of property buyers. On the other hand, property buyers suffer from inadequate consumer rights and lengthy redressal mechanisms. The paper details out the issues faced by property buyers in Indian Housing Market and various redressal mechanisms available to them. The paper also discusses the two proposed acts by GOI that intends to improve transparency and adoption of best market practices in the sector, namely Real Estate Regulation and Development Act 2009 and Model Land Titling Act 2010. If implemented effectively, these two acts have the potential to significantly improve the organisational efficiency of the sector and ensure a balanced participation of the property buyers in the housing market.
